Afenyo-Markin busing soldiers to Effutu for illegal transfer of votes- NDC

The Central Regional Chairman of the National Democratic Congress (NDC), Professor Richard Kofi Asiedu has accused the Member of Parliament for Effutu, Alexander Afenyo-Markin of illegally busing at least 71 soldiers in the name of transfer of votes into the Constituency.

According to Prof. Asiedu, the rules designed by the Electoral Commission that govern the special voting for security agencies have elapsed. He added that he finds it very intriguing that Mr Afenyo-Markin flouts the laws to get these soldiers registered and transfer their votes to Effutu.

Prof Asiedu said, the special voting window has ended but the MP has managed to bring in several soldiers who have illegally transferred their votes to Effutu Constituency.

He stressed that the EC officials should act fast to see those names expunged from the register before the unexpected things happened.

“We know the EC has laws that deal with the security agencies when it comes to special voting, and that epoch in that regard has ended so under what command is Afenyo-Markin acting to bring at least 71 soldiers to transfer their votes to Effutu Constituency so as to vote on December 7. So, EC we’ve questions to ask you and if this video gets to you, your outfit ought to act fast before the unexpected thing happens. Those names should be removed from the register if not we will advise ourselves,” Prof Asiedu warned.

He reiterated that the party will hold a press conference to demand answers from the EC on how these soldiers can get registered and transfer their votes to Effutu Constituency for the 2024 elections.
